Blackhawks Not Planning A Reunion With Patrick Kane
                
        
        Chicago Blackhawks legend Patrick Kane is unlikely to return to the team. Kane, who left the Windy City last year, is set for unrestricted free agency this offseason, but it looks like he won't receive any offers from the Blackhawks. "I think we made some really tough decisions on some longstanding players," said Blackhawks general manager Kyle Davidson at the recent NHL Draft Combine. "I don't foresee us going back on that." After recovering from hip surgery, Kane skated with the Detroit Red Wings this season, posting 20 goals and 47 points in 50 appearances. The 35-year-old proved that he can still do the business in the league and should draw quite a bit of interest on the open market.
